Fan-out backpressure for the Quillet notifier: when the queue depth crosses the soft limit, the dispatcher sheds low-priority pushes and batches the rest at 500ms intervals. Reviewer should confirm the shed counter is exported and that retries respect the jitter window. Once merged, the release artifact gets re-signed by the pipeline, which expects the deploy key shown below.

deploy key for bawep-yawif: bky6_GQhaSt

Subject: Quick word on the Brindlemoor deal

Team — welcome aboard to our incoming director, Sorel Vanning. Short version: talks with Brindlemoor Instruments are further along than most of the company knows. Diligence wraps in three weeks, and the price band looks workable. Sorel, you'll get the full data pack tomorrow. For now, keep this tight — details directly below.

internal memo for kaduf-baduf: Only 35 of the 378 pilot accounts renewed Holir, so a churn review is set for June 11. Eliielax Group is in early talks to buy Silaelix Group for about $142.1 million.

Runbook: Scanline barcode integration. Before promoting a release, verify the scanner bridge handshakes with the Wrenfield POS mock and that malformed barcodes return a rejection code rather than crashing the parser. Run the fixture suite twice to catch the intermittent USB timeout. If both passes are clean, the release is eligible. Record the candidate against the build token below.

pipeline stamp: htk14_5717f383a4ad4f

# Circuit breaker config for the Marlowe upstream API.
# Trips after 5 consecutive failures; half-open probe every 30s.
# If the breaker is stuck open, check Marlowe status before touching thresholds.
# Do NOT disable the breaker in prod — page the platform lead instead.
# Probe calls authenticate against Marlowe's health endpoint, and the credential for those probes is set on the following line.

vault entry, kahip-fahog: RELAY_SECRET20=6a2c791de808f35c3b55